Explanation:

The 2007/2008 Wastewater System Master Plan identified the need to replace the reuse distribution pumps in order to increase the reuse system capacity to allow for additional reuse customers.

 

During Phase 1 of the Reuse System Expansion, the City converted two abandoned sludge holding tanks at the Southern Regional Wastewater Treatment Plant into flow equalization basins to dampen diurnal flow variations from Davie/Cooper City effluent streams.

 

Phase 2 of the Reuse System Expansion upsizes the reuse water pumps to meet the increased demand in the system and provide operation flexibility.

 

On April 16, 2014, via Resolution R-2014-091, the City Commission approved the issuance of an Authorization to Proceed to Hazen and Sawyer, P.C. for the design, permitting, and bidding services for the Reuse System Expansion Phase II at the Southern Regional Wastewater Treatment Plant.

 

On November 11, 2015, Department of Public Utilities staff advertised for construction services, and on December 18, 2015, three (3) bid proposals were received and publicly opened at the Southern Regional Wastewater Treatment Plant with the following results

After thoroughly evaluating the bid proposals for compliance with the contract documents, Hazen and Sawyer, P.C. staff determined that the lowest bidder, Florida Design Contractors, Inc., is the lowest responsive and responsible bidder.

 

A Notice of Intent to Award related to the project was posted in the City of Hollywood website, in DemandStar on January 26, 2016 and resulted in no bid protests.

 

The Department of Public Utilities requested a proposal from Hazen and Sawyer, P.C. to provide construction administration services during the construction phase of the Reuse System Expansion Phase II project.

 

Hazen and Sawyer, P.C. submitted a comprehensive proposal for construction administration services during the construction phase of the Reuse System Expansion Phase II Project in an amount not to exceed $75,600.00.

 

Hazen and Sawyer, P.C. and the City of Hollywood have a Professional Services Agreement for General Engineering Consulting Services for wastewater projects, and this agreement was approved by the City Commission via Resolution No. R-2003-003 on January 8, 2003; amended by the City Commission via Resolution No. R-2012-152 on June 6, 2012; renewed by the City Commission via Resolution No. R-2013-110 on May 1, 2013; renewed by the City Commission via Resolution R-2015-068 on April 01, 2015;  and this agreement has a provision for insurance and indemnification that meets the City’s requirements and gives the City the right to terminate for convenience.

 

The Administration recommends that the City Commission authorize the appropriate City Officials to execute the attached contract between Florida Design Contractors, Inc., and the City of Hollywood in the amount of $840,000.00 for the construction of the Reuse System Expansion Phase II at the Southern Regional Wastewater Treatment Plant, and to execute the attached Authorization to Proceed for Work Order No. H&S 16-01 between Hazen and Sawyer, P.C. and the City of Hollywood for construction administration services, in an amount not to exceed of $75,600.00.

 

It is necessary to amend the approved FY 2016 Capital Improvement Program and allocate funding for the contract amount of $840,000.00; construction administration services of $75,600.00; and for program management services, permits and testing of $75,000.00 for the aggregate total amount of $990,600.00 as set forth in attached Exhibit A.

 

It is estimated that the time period to complete this work is 365 days from the Notice to Proceed date.
